C# Класс Mono.UIAutomation.Winforms.ProviderFactory

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
FindProvider ( Component component ) : IRawElementProviderFragment
GetFormProviders ( ) : List
GetProvider ( Component component ) : IRawElementProviderFragment
GetProvider ( Component component, bool initialize ) : IRawElementProviderFragment
GetProvider ( Component component, bool initialize, bool forceInitializeChildren ) : IRawElementProviderFragment
ReleaseProvider ( Component component ) : void

Приватные методы

Метод Описание
InitializeProviderHash ( ) : void
ProviderFactory ( ) : System
RegisterComponentProviderMapper ( System componentType, ComponentProviderMapperHandler handler ) : void

Описание методов

FindProvider() публичный статический Метод

public static FindProvider ( Component component ) : IRawElementProviderFragment
component System.ComponentModel.Component
Результат IRawElementProviderFragment

GetFormProviders() публичный статический Метод

public static GetFormProviders ( ) : List
Результат List

GetProvider() публичный статический Метод

public static GetProvider ( Component component ) : IRawElementProviderFragment
component System.ComponentModel.Component
Результат IRawElementProviderFragment

GetProvider() публичный статический Метод

public static GetProvider ( Component component, bool initialize ) : IRawElementProviderFragment
component System.ComponentModel.Component
initialize bool
Результат IRawElementProviderFragment

GetProvider() публичный статический Метод

public static GetProvider ( Component component, bool initialize, bool forceInitializeChildren ) : IRawElementProviderFragment
component System.ComponentModel.Component
initialize bool
forceInitializeChildren bool
Результат IRawElementProviderFragment

ReleaseProvider() публичный статический Метод

public static ReleaseProvider ( Component component ) : void
component System.ComponentModel.Component
Результат void